Build a Custom DevOps Platform Based on RocketMQ Prometheus Exporter
RocketMQ is a distributed message and streaming data platform featuring low latency, high performance, high reliability, trillions of capacity, and flexible extensibility. In other words, it consists of a broker server and a client. The client includes a message producer which sends messages to the broker server and a message consumer. Multiple consumers can form a consumer group to subscribe to and pull messages stored on the broker server.

Got fed up with AMQP, so I wrote a HTTP message broker on top of RabbitMQ
Let's draw some parallels in the Kafka ecosystem, in which there are Confluent REST Proxy and Hermes by Allegro. You could say that since Kafka uses a binary protocol over TCP, both of these projects are "moot and useless". Despite that, Allegro aka the Poland's Amazon still maintains that project and uses it in production as a means of HTTP-based communication between their 700+ microservices arguing that it makes their development process easier, since it allows them to abstract away the intricacies of Kafka and use plain HTTP instead.
